The hieracosphinx is a mythical beast, a gryphon-like chimera found in Egyptian sculpture and European heraldry comprising a lion with the gryphon's aquiline head replaced by that of a falcon. The name was coined byHerodotus to the falcon-headed sphinxes that he saw in Egypt, the other being the ram-headed sphinx, which Herodotus called Criosphinx. The hieracosphinx is taken by some as an augury of the evil.
